SACE Drama production

🎭 On Friday 29 May our talented Year 11 and 12 Drama students captivated the Friday evening audience with their moving performance of ‘Where Words Once Were’. Set in a dystopian city where the government strictly limits language to 1,000 words and pens are forbidden, the play follows young Orhan’s courageous journey as he discovers a banned pen and encounters a girl silenced by society.

The performance began with our actors challenging the audience to think of a word they could not live without setting the tone for their evocative storytelling and powerful acting. Our students brought to life the complexities of identity, freedom, and hope. Thank you to everyone who attended and supported this unforgettable night of theatre at Hamilton Secondary College.
